ISLAMABAD – Deputy Secretary National Security Council of the RussiaFederation Mikhail Popov called on Foreign Secretary Tehmina Janjua at theMinistry of Foreign Affairs here on Wednesday. Mr Popov is in Pakistan tohold consultations with his counterparts.
According to Foreign office statement, both sides discussed defence andsecurity relations and expressed satisfaction on the current level ofcooperation in this context.
The Foreign Secretary elaborated on Pakistan’s improved security situationin the country and ongoing counter terrorism efforts. She also expressedsatisfaction at increasing military and technical cooperation betweenPakistan and Russia.
The talks were marked by convergence of views between the two sides onvarious global and regional issues of mutual interest, she added.
The Russian side expressed deep appreciation and acknowledged Pakistan’scontribution and sacrifices in the fight against terrorism. They alsorecognized the need for joint efforts for peace, security and stability inthe region.
Initiated this year, the talks between the high-level security officials ofPakistan and Russia provide a useful platform for engagement on wide rangeof issues.
